黑狐家游戏

数据仓库的存储结构中,其所涉及的索引结构有,深入解析数据仓库存储结构中的索引结构

欧气 0 0

本文目录导读:

数据仓库的存储结构中,其所涉及的索引结构有,深入解析数据仓库存储结构中的索引结构

图片来源于网络,如有侵权联系删除

  1. 数据仓库存储结构概述
  2. 数据仓库存储结构中的索引结构

数据仓库作为企业数据分析和决策支持的核心,其存储结构的设计至关重要,索引结构作为提高数据查询效率的关键因素,在数据仓库中扮演着重要角色,本文将深入解析数据仓库存储结构中涉及的索引结构,旨在为读者提供全面、深入的理解。

数据仓库存储结构概述

数据仓库存储结构主要包括以下几种:

1、星型模型:星型模型由事实表和维度表组成,事实表记录业务数据,维度表提供业务数据的上下文信息,星型模型结构简单,便于查询和分析。

2、雪花模型:雪花模型在星型模型的基础上,对维度表进行进一步细化,将部分维度表转换为更详细的子表,雪花模型可以提供更丰富的数据粒度,但查询性能可能低于星型模型。

3、星型-雪花混合模型:星型-雪花混合模型结合了星型模型和雪花模型的优点,根据业务需求选择合适的模型。

数据仓库存储结构中的索引结构

1、基本索引

基本索引包括主键索引和唯一索引,主键索引用于唯一标识数据仓库中的每一条记录,保证数据的唯一性;唯一索引用于确保字段值的唯一性。

(1)主键索引:数据仓库中,事实表的主键通常由多个字段组成,如时间、事件类型、产品ID等,主键索引可以加快基于主键的查询操作。

数据仓库的存储结构中,其所涉及的索引结构有,深入解析数据仓库存储结构中的索引结构

图片来源于网络,如有侵权联系删除

(2)唯一索引:维度表中的某些字段可能需要建立唯一索引,以保证数据的准确性,客户表中的客户ID字段需要建立唯一索引。

2、聚集索引

聚集索引是一种将数据按照特定顺序存储的索引,可以提高查询效率,数据仓库中常见的聚集索引有:

(1)时间序列索引:根据时间字段建立聚集索引,便于查询历史数据。

(2)事件序列索引:根据事件类型字段建立聚集索引,便于查询特定事件类型的数据。

3、哈希索引

哈希索引是一种将数据按照哈希函数散列到不同的桶中的索引,数据仓库中,哈希索引主要用于:

(1)快速访问数据:哈希索引可以快速定位数据,提高查询效率。

数据仓库的存储结构中,其所涉及的索引结构有,深入解析数据仓库存储结构中的索引结构

图片来源于网络,如有侵权联系删除

(2)支持并行查询:哈希索引可以支持并行查询,提高查询性能。

4、全文索引

全文索引是一种用于文本数据的索引,可以快速检索包含特定词汇或短语的文本数据,数据仓库中,全文索引主要用于:

(1)支持文本搜索:全文索引可以支持文本搜索,提高文本数据的查询效率。

(2)提高数据利用率:全文索引可以提取文本数据中的关键信息,提高数据利用率。

数据仓库存储结构中的索引结构是提高数据查询效率的关键因素,本文从基本索引、聚集索引、哈希索引和全文索引等方面,深入解析了数据仓库存储结构中的索引结构,了解这些索引结构有助于优化数据仓库的设计,提高数据查询性能。

标签: #数据仓库的存储结构中 #其所涉及的索引结构有

黑狐家游戏
  • 评论列表

留言评论